The story

Harar International Cultural Festival in Harar

A cultural festival showcasing Harar's UNESCO-listed walled old town and its blended Harari, Oromo, Somali and Amhara heritage, likely drawing on the city's crafts, cuisine and traditions including its famous nightly hyena-feeding ritual. Independently verifiable detail on this specific festival's founding year and programme is limited compared to the extensively documented history of the city itself.

The place changes

Harar's UNESCO World Heritage status for its exceptionally dense concentration of historic Islamic architecture within a compact walled old town, and its distinctive nightly hyena-feeding ritual practiced just outside the city walls, are genuinely unique, well-documented features that would give any Harar cultural festival a specific identity unmatched elsewhere in Ethiopia

What to wear

Modest, comfortable clothing suits both the walled old town's narrow alleys and its Islamic cultural context; sturdy walking shoes are practical given the compact, foot-traffic-only layout.
